Influence of Cr2O3 on Sintering Process of CaO Ceramics

Abstract

The influence of Cr^j additives on sintering process of CaO ceramics was studied. The results showed that Ct£), could improve the density and the hydration resistance performance of CaO ceramics. The hydration resistance performance increased with the content of G2O3. The density and hydration resistance performance of CaO ceramic increased when the sintering temperature increased. During the sintering, the new phase CaCrA linked the CaO crystal grains and promoted sintering, and improved the density of ceramics. The CaO crystal grains were wrapped by CaCr2O4, which improved the hydration resistance performance of CaO ceramics further.
